Problems and solutions:

1.. On some benches (typically E1) ) the ICS finds it very difficult to turn the wheel to bring the magnet in cold position (for Lyre test). This problem is solved temporarily. But if the problem comes again, ICS will stop. The concerned operator should contact the Shift leader / TC for calling mechanics.

2.. TBB1 - SSS196, Iearth value too high in 1500A provoked quench. Richard did various tests and then decided to go for training. After 2 quenches the magnet reached ultimate. Stephane checked all the quench data and found OK. The problem is suspected in LF card and it may appear again.

3.. TBD2 - SSS155, D1-D2 not compensated. Error was found in voltage tap connection for Diode. Also the problem in LF rack was corrected. The magnet is cooled once again and IAP at cold should be carried out on high priority basis for further investigation.

4.. Polarity switch on cluster B could not be changed because the rod could not be released. Georgio will look into the matter very soon.

5.. Saturday CRYO was very slow due to leak. Problem solved and CRYO is expected to be normal.

Instructions for Operators

1.. If the polarity swith is hard to move. please do not force and better stop. Call equipment support. These switches are very delicate and difficult to replace. Please be more careful everytime.

2.. To close any LabView window please use the Exit button, do not use the 'Windows' close buttons. By using the windows close buttons directly, it is found that some applications do not close properly.

3.. There are two ways to see the data of quench heaters discharge, thru HF and LF data acquisitions. If due to some reason 'hfoff' does not show proper result check the graphs in 'lfoff'. If still the problem exists call equipment support. Otherwise equipment support need not be called during odd hours, during daytime they can just be informed that results are OK with 'lfoff' and NOT OK with 'hfoff'.

4.. For magnets with anticrostat, some times the operators forget to scan Anticrostat, this causes problems in further tests. Before proceeding the scan one should check whether the magnet is with or without Anticryostat.

5.. If you find that there is a communication error with PLCSE, call equipment support.
